The Associate Director, Patient Support Services Analytics & Reporting will be responsible for leading analytics and reporting of Patient Support Services (PSS) metrics and performing analyses on PSS programs and projects. This individual will be an integral partner to the US Rare Diseases PSS leadership team, supporting patient journey, conversion, adherence analyses as well as providing Insights. In addition, this individual will be responsible for proactively identifying areas of opportunity through use of PSP, SP (Specialty Pharmacy), and claims data. This position reports to Senior Director, PSS Analytics & Reporting.

Main Responsibilities:
Design, develop, and measure key performance indicators (KPI) associated with patient services strategies, tactics, and programs. Lead development, production, and maintenance of KPI dashboards for the SPC PSS team. 35%
Run and analyze daily automated analytics by direct review in the Microsoft Power BI Tool.
Define and design the logic/code for patient services KPIs for individual patient services field forces in collaboration with team Directors.
Define and design the logic/code for patient services KPIs for operations teams and program-level business goals.
Create, run, and validate insights provided to leadership, operations, and internal patient services teams – established performance indicators are industry-standard such as number of tasks completed for a given field team or number of enrolled patients in the given patient services program.
Collaborate with patient services leadership and marketing teams to provide key product insights to GM via monthly review and more frequent launch-specific data readouts.
User Lead for PSS Dashboard development:
Directly perform user acceptance testing (UAT) in the UAT instance of the dashboards.
Receive initial requests for troubleshooting and/or defects from users, related to dashboard performance or issues with displayed results.
Act as strategic partner to the SPC patient services leadership in key activities, such as brand planning, performance reviews, product launches, and assessment of new initiatives. 35%
Deliver a business needs-driven set of insights via monthly/weekly/daily reports for various stakeholders – via Power BI reports, CRM extracts, or summary tables.
Update and deliver periodic insights via Power BI PowerPoint Add-ins
Catalog and industrialize frequently requested reporting needs to continually enhance existing analytics dashboards or add to the queue for new development.
Lead patient services Analytics/Insights training and user experience (currently iCare Insights Analytics Tool):
Train team members on the analytics tool via direct training sessions. Zoom or in-person.
Collaborate with tool users over specific issues/questions for pulling various views or reports for their individual business needs.
Partner with SPC Brand analytics and forecasting teams to ensure alignment of KPIs across Commercial and PSS reporting.
Conduct process flow mapping analyses to understand patient and HCP barriers to starting treatment
Perform ad-hoc sub-national analyses to proactively identify areas of opportunities and threats, leveraging PSS program and tactic utilization, field activities, and customer adoption metrics.
Directly query the database using SQL and Python to provide ad hoc analytics or reports across SPC patient services needs.
Create and deliver ad hoc reports from available tools – direct exports from the dashboards, CRM (Customer Relationship Management) extracts, or tailored lists of patients/claims/tasks etc.
Maintain a query repository for users in PSS to have the ability to directly run specific custom analyses.
Coordinate with data management to ensure insights are based on reliable, high-quality information.10%
Perform daily quality checks on existing dashboards in the iCare Insights analytics tool. Defects are escalated appropriately to the iCare Connect (CRM) team and/or data management team.
Collaborate at-minimum weekly with data management team to align on any changes at the data source layer or to the ETL process that might have an impact on patient services metrics.
